On January 5, 2021, the 63rd Annual Grammy Awards were postponed from January 31 to March 14 due to the COVID-19 situation in Los Angeles. [464] The ceremony featured a mix of live and pre-recorded segments and was filmed without an audience at the Los Angeles Convention Center.
